Output d21dd4f756660aec5914438f96d77666acda0508a1204937b7dbbe089f31e8d4:0

value
306460445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0053bd25c9e829eae856e5d76401268951c41852 OP_EQUAL
address
31ikEpc7WoxQXcKjPYDrewzMRzRX9giWj3
transaction
d21dd4f756660aec5914438f96d77666acda0508a1204937b7dbbe089f31e8d4
spent
true